I pulled out a stamp set I've had for 3 years, and used two of the stamps for the first time on this card: the cuckoo clock and the sentiment. Also, I created the background paper with a stamp I won 3 years ago from a Unity FWF challenge. That also saw ink for the first time. On the inside, I added another sentiment (with a bit of snark!) to finish my card.

Supplies:
Stamps: Unity/Samantha Walker - Cuckoo Clocks, Unity FWF 2013 winnings - clock faces; LOL/Hampton Arts - Officially Old
Ink: Memento - Nautical Blue, Rich Cocoa
DP: Echo Park - Times & Seasons
CS: Bazzill, Darice
Accessories: GC; Cuttlebug - Labels & Such dies; Fiskars - corner rounder; Michael's - burlap ribbon
Adhesives: SA by 3L - tape runner, 3D & Thin 3D foam squares; Recollections - red tape
